Sentence examples for a topic of considerable debate from inspiring English sources

The phrase "a topic of considerable debate"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ing subjects that are controversial or have differing opinions among people.
Example: "Climate change remains a topic of considerable debate among scientists and policymakers."
Alternatives: "a subject of significant discussion" or "an issue of much contention".
